系统数据存储方式的高效管理与优化策略是确保数据安全、提高访问速度和降低维护成本的关键。以下是一些有效的策略:
1. 选择合适的存储介质:根据应用需求,选择适合的存储介质,如硬盘、固态硬盘或磁带等。不同的存储介质具有不同的性能特点,需要根据实际应用场景进行选择。
2. 采用分布式存储:将数据分散存储在多个物理位置,以提高数据的可用性和容错能力。分布式存储可以有效地减少单点故障的风险,提高系统的可靠性。
3. 使用缓存技术:通过在内存中缓存频繁访问的数据,可以减少对磁盘的访问次数,提高数据访问速度。同时,缓存还可以减轻数据库的压力,提高整体性能。
4. 实施数据压缩:通过压缩技术减小数据文件的大小,从而减少磁盘空间的占用和数据传输的时间。数据压缩可以提高存储效率,降低存储成本。
5. 优化查询和索引:通过优化查询语句和创建合适的索引,可以提高数据库的查询效率。合理的查询和索引设计可以加快数据检索速度,降低系统响应时间。
6. 实现数据分区和分片:将大型数据集划分为较小的部分,以便于管理和处理。数据分区和分片可以提高数据的可管理性,方便进行数据备份和恢复操作。
7. 使用对象存储:对象存储是一种基于键值对的存储方式,可以有效地管理大量非结构化数据。对象存储具有高扩展性和高可用性的特点,适合处理大规模数据。
8. 实现数据备份和恢复:定期对数据进行备份,以防止数据丢失。同时,建立完善的数据恢复机制,确保在发生故障时能够快速恢复数据。
9. 监控和分析:通过监控系统的性能指标,如CPU使用率、磁盘I/O等,及时发现并解决问题。同时,利用数据分析工具对数据进行深入分析,发现潜在的问题并进行优化。
10. 制定数据治理策略:制定数据质量管理、数据生命周期管理等策略,确保数据的准确性、完整性和一致性。数据治理可以帮助企业更好地利用数据资源,提高业务价值。
总之,系统数据存储方式的高效管理与优化策略包括选择合适的存储介质、采用分布式存储、使用缓存技术、实施数据压缩、优化查询和索引、实现数据分区和分片、使用对象存储、实现数据备份和恢复、监控和分析以及制定数据治理策略等多个方面。通过综合运用这些策略,可以有效提高系统数据存储的效率和质量,为企业带来更大的价值。